Vision Correction Through Glass and Lenses

Throughout history, humanity has striven to improve its vision. Early attempts involved fitting natural objects such as polished stones or water over the eyes. However, it wasn't until the discovery of glass that true vision correction became feasible. The earliest glasses were simple plus lenses, which enlarged objects, mainly used for reading.

Over time, the science of optics advanced, leading to the manufacture of various lens types, each designed to rectify for specific eye defects. Today, a wide range of spectacles and soft lenses are available to address nearsightedness, farsightedness, astigmatism, and presbyopia.
